LEONARD, EXECUTRIX, v. DOLAWAY


76 Pa. D. & C. 452 (1951)

Leonard, Executrix, v. Dolaway

Common Pleas Court of Cameron County, Pennsylvania.

May 25, 1951.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Driscoll, Gregory & Coppolo, for plaintiff.

Edwin W. Tompkins, for defendant.


HIPPLE, P.J., May 25, 1951.

Plaintiff, executrix of the last will of Dewey Leonard, deceased, filed a complaint in assumpsit alleging that defendant, owner of the Warner Hotel in Emporium, Cameron County, Pa., is indebted to the estate of Dewey Leonard in the sum of $5,584.14, with interest from October 7, 1948, for work and materials furnished on a "cost plus 10 per cent" contract for remodeling defendant's hotel; that Dewey Leonard, a building contractor before...
